Superfighters Deluxe has come a long way since its early days in 2012 . While the Steam release is the definitive way to play, these archived .rar files preserve the "wild west" era of the game’s development. Whether it’s testing out old fire mechanics—which can burn you 7.5x faster if a flamethrower is involved—or playing on experimental destructible maps, the history of SFD is alive in these archives.

: Some players maintain archives of older versions , such as Pre-Alpha 1.8.4 or Alpha 1.3.4c. These are digital time capsules that let you experience the melee combat and "no-grab" mechanics of years past.
